LA indie rock band The Elizabeth Kill continue their journey in rock muziki with a brand new album titled “The Other Side of Vain.” The female-fronted rock band came back strong on this fourth studio release effectively ending their hiatus. wewe can buy “The Other Side of Vain” on iTunes at: link This talented group of musicians each have decades of experience to draw form and are inspired kwa acts such as Jim Morrison, pink Floyd, Rush, and Queen. Not only do they create great muziki but they put on artistic and electrifying live performances that are something that shouldn’t be missed.
